Chery Pakistan unveils flagship Tiggo 9 PHEV with premium features and 1.36 crore rupee ex-factory price
Chinese automotive brand Chery Pakistan officially launched its flagship Tiggo 9 Plug-in Hybrid Electric Vehicle (PHEV) in Pakistan, marking a significant step in the local hybrid SUV market. The ex-factory price for the seven-seater all-wheel-drive SUV is set at 1.3694 million Pakistani rupees, with an initial booking fee of 3 million rupees.
The Tiggo 9 PHEV features a 1.5-liter turbocharged engine combined with three electric motors and a 34.46 kWh battery, producing a total output of 610 horsepower and 920 Nm of torque. It can travel up to 145 kilometers on battery alone, while the combined fuel and battery range reaches 1,190 kilometers.
Inside, the SUV offers a 15.6-inch infotainment touchscreen, a 14-speaker Sony audio system, panoramic sunroof, and 20-inch alloy wheels. Comfort features include six-way adjustable heated, ventilated, and massaging front seats, and heated and ventilated second-row seats. Safety is enhanced with 10 airbags, advanced ADAS technology, automated parking assistance, heated leather steering, remote control, voice assistance, and headrest speakers.
The launch follows Chery’s showcase at the PAPS Auto Show in November 2025, which presented the Tiggo 7, Tiggo 8, and Tiggo 9 PHEV models. The Tiggo 7 PHEV is expected to debut later this year.
